Hope that abounds

Hope enables you to reach out to claim, bring to fulfilment the promises of God for your life.
Expectations are developed by your thoughts, your emotions, what you see and what you hear.
God does not want us to base our expectations on what we think and feel.

God wants our expectations to be lifted by the Hope of the Gospel. Based on the promises in the living word of God. Faith and hope are combined in the heart of the believer, bring forth a unity that builds the expectation of hope to bloom in their lives. To believe God for all things, with God nothing shall be impossible. For with our God we can do all things. Nothing shall be able to stand before us. If God be for us who can stand against us. Our expectations build a platform for trust in the living God, I learn to depend upon His word to meet my every need, according to his riches and glory through Christ Jesus, my Hope of Glory.

We are certain that what we hope for is already waiting for us. God has already prepared for us to receive what He has promised. Hope is not limited to what you see as your present situation or what you see for your future. Hope enables you to focus, enables you to see with a greater level of expectation. I see with the eyes of faith that the promises of God are true. That God is no respecter of persons, but all that humble themselves and seek His face will be rewarded and He will hear our prayers and bring to pass the promises and blessings He has in store for us.

Hope is more than wishing. Hope is a powerful force God has placed within us.
Greek word for Hope is ‘elps’ means happy expectation of good…
Expectations means reaching out in readiness to receive something.

Hope is a happy reaching out in readiness to receive something good. This Hope is not based upon or limited to what you see or hear. Hope is based on the living faith that abides in you, the gift of live that God gave you when you called upon him to be your Lord and saviour. This gift of faith enables your to see with eyes of expectation to believe for all things to come to pass. That our God is faithful to watch over his word, to perform his good will for our lives. He who shed his life for us, shall he not also give good things to those that call out upon Him, in their time of need.

Hope that is alive is fortified by the power of God, by His Spirit that dwells withing us. This hope that lives within us gives us the full assurance that we are going to be receiving the good things from God our heavenly Father wants to give us good things. Just like our earthly Father would give his child good things when asked. If you ask for bread he will not give you a stone. So also your Heavenly Father will give good things to those that ask of him.

Hope – Living Hope is given to us from God. This hope keeps us stead fast, is an anchor for the soul, is based, strengthened by the word of God.

My hope is built on nothing less

Than Jesus’ blood and righteousness.

I dare not trust the sweetest frame,

But wholly trust in Jesus’ Name.

Now the God of Hope fill you with all joy and peace in believing that ye may abound in hope through the power of the Holy Ghost. Rom 15:13

Let God manifest His glory and presence in your life as you believe Him to bring the promises of God into your life. This living hope gives us access beyond the veil into the very presence of God We have the assurance of His promises, through the Holy Spirit that has been given to us. Our hope and expectations must be centered on Christ the living Word, and on his completed work on Calvary.

And hope maketh not ashamed; because the love of God is shed abroad in our hearts by the Holy Ghost which is given unto us. Rom 5:5

Its Christ in us the Hope of Glory, we have the indwelling Spirit and power of God residing with us in our lives and will teach us how to apprehend the things of God. Teach us to believe for all things. God want to restore a rewarding relationship with you and the true living God. God want you to experience his deep love and commitment to you. That by his Spirit he will give you and I access unto himself. Let us call upon the Lord and He will hear us and show us great and mighty things.

For I am persuaded, that neither death, nor life, nor angels, nor principalities, nor powers, nor things present, nor things to come, Nor height, nor depth, nor any other creature, shall be able to separate us from the love of God, which is in Christ Jesus our Lord. Rom 8:38-39 

There is no power in heaven or on earth that can separate us from Fathers love.

He reached down from heaven to save us from our sins, and bring us into the family of God. He is a loving Father, that gives life to his creation. It is the devil that came to kill and destroy. God sent Jesus to give us life and that life more abundantly. If we believe in the Lord Jesus Christ, ye shall be saved. God gives you a new life, by the power of His Holy Spirit he unites us with himself. He says I will never leave you nor forsake you.

The enemy of our soul, the worldly influence will try to blind us from the love of God. You can not always rely on your feelings and whatever thoughts are passing through your mind. We need to put our Trust in the Word of God. We may endure suffer and apparent times of loneliness, but joy comes in the morning. When the light of God and His  understanding renews our faith and confidence, then we know that He has never left us, we were just not aware of his presence.

Learn to pray and seek his face and he will reveal himself to you and you shall begin to sense the warmth of his presence and joy in your life. The presence of God in our live bring joy, peace and righteousness. His presence comes by abiding in His Word, by magnifying his Name. By giving praises to God, this will enable us to be free from the cares of this world and open our eyes to the beauty and love that God has for you and I. May his peace keep you and his grace will strengthen and empower you to live your life with the joy of the Lord richly seated in your heart.
